Fatima Robinson is a world-class dancer and choreographer who has pivoted to directing. You know Fatima’s work, from Michael Jackson’s “Remember The Time” to the Emmy-winning Dr. Dre-led Superbowl Halftime Show to Beyoncé’s Renaissance Tour. In a Questlove Supreme conversation, Fatima gushes with passion for dance and hip-hop as she looks back at incredible work with Aaliyah, Michael, and Kendrick Lamar, to name a few. Fatima and Ahmir also reflect on collaborating on the two televised performances celebrating Hip Hop’s 50th anniversary.
